    Erin Meyer is een auteur die zich verdiept in de complexiteit van internationale zakelijke relaties. Haar werk richt zich op het analyseren van hoe culturele verschillen zich manifesteren in het mondiale bedrijfsleven en hoe deze effectief te navigeren. Door haar onderzoek en onderwijs helpt ze professionals de onzichtbare grenzen te begrijpen die wereldwijde samenwerking beïnvloeden. Haar benadering biedt waardevolle inzichten in de nuances van internationale communicatie en management.

      Of im Heimatland of im buitenland, zakelijk succes in een geglobaliseerde wereld vereist de vaardigheid om culturele verschillen te navigeren. Erin Meyer, een gerenommeerde expert, leidt door dit complexe terrein waar mensen met verschillende achtergronden moeten samenwerken. Zelfs met Engels als globale taal kunnen culturele misverstanden ontstaan die carrières in gevaar brengen. Voorbeelden zijn een Braziliaanse manager die de werkwijze van zijn Chinese leverancier wil begrijpen, of een Amerikaanse chef die de dynamiek tussen Russische en Indiase teamleden moet managen. De "Culture Map" biedt een praxiserprobte model om te begrijpen hoe culturele verschillen het internationale succes beïnvloeden. Meyer combineert een analytisch framework met praktische tips om de effectiviteit van samenwerking te verhogen. Acht dimensies, waaronder communiceren, leiden en vertrouwen, worden bekeken. Deze helpen om medewerkers te motiveren, klanten te plezieren of succesvolle conference calls te plannen. Lezers leren hun positie in de culturele context te herkennen en te begrijpen hoe cultuur de internationale samenwerking beïnvloedt om misverstanden te vermijden.

    • In today's global and virtual business landscape, executives and managers must collaborate with colleagues from diverse cultures, often without face-to-face interaction. This diversity can lead to misunderstandings, as cultural differences shape communication styles and expectations. For instance, while Americans may cushion criticism with compliments, others, like the French or Germans, may be more direct. Similarly, hierarchical norms in Latin America and Asia contrast sharply with Scandinavian egalitarianism. Despite English being a common language, cultural nuances can create pitfalls that jeopardize careers and negotiations. Renowned expert Erin Meyer offers practical insights into how cultural differences influence global business interactions. She emphasizes the importance of understanding these cultural drivers to enhance business success. With the rise of global call centers, outsourcing, and international project teams, cultural diversity impacts nearly everyone in the workforce. Globalization connects employees from various countries, yet many managers lack an understanding of how local cultures affect their interactions. Even those well-traveled may struggle with the complexities of cross-cultural collaboration. Meyer's work provides essential strategies for navigating these challenges and fostering effective communication in the modern global marketplace.

    • Whether you work in a home office or abroad, business success in our ever more globalized and virtual world requires the skills to navigate through cultural differences and decode cultures foreign to your own. Renowned expert Erin Meyer is your guide through this subtle, sometimes treacherous terrain where people from starkly different backgrounds are expected to work harmoniously together. When you have Americans who precede anything negative with three nice comments; French, Dutch, Israelis, and Germans who get straight to the point (your presentation was simply awful”); Latin Americans and Asians who are steeped in hierarchy; Scandinavians who think the best boss is just one of the crowdthe result can be, well, sometimes interesting, even funny, but often disastrous. Even with English as a global language, it's easy to fall into cultural traps that endanger careers and sink deals when, say, a Brazilian manager tries to fathom how his Chinese suppliers really get things done, or an American team leader tries to get a handle on the intra-team dynamics between his Russian and Indian team members. In The Culture Map, Erin Meyer provides a field-tested model for decoding how cultural differences impact international business. She combines a smart analytical framework with practical, actionable advice for succeeding in a global world.

      Netflix cofounder Reed Hastings unveils the unconventional culture that has propelled the company to become a leader in the entertainment industry. Netflix stands out not just for its revenue or global reach, but for its radical management principles that defy tradition. Hastings developed a set of counterintuitive practices that enable constant reinvention, emphasizing people over processes and innovation over efficiency. In this unique environment, adequate performance results in generous severance, and employees are encouraged to engage in radical candor rather than merely seeking to please their bosses. Approval is not required for actions, and the company offers top-market compensation. When these principles were first established, their implications were largely unknown, yet they have fostered unprecedented flexibility and boldness. This culture of freedom and responsibility has allowed Netflix to adapt and thrive alongside changing global demands. Hastings, along with Erin Meyer, bestselling author and influential business thinker, explores the controversial philosophies that define Netflix's success. Drawing on interviews with current and former employees and sharing untold stories from Hastings' career, this narrative reveals the fascinating journey of a company that continues to make a significant impact worldwide.

    • Penguin Readers is an ELT graded reading series, designed for teenagers and young adults learning English as a foreign language. With carefully adapted text, new illustrations, language practice activities and additional online resources, the Penguin Readers series introduces language learners to bestselling authors and compelling content. Titles include popular classics, exciting contemporary fiction, and thought-provoking non-fiction. No Rules Rules, a Level 4 Reader, is A2+ in the CEFR framework. The text is made up of sentences with up to three clauses, introducing more complex uses of present perfect simple, passives, phrasal verbs and simple relative clauses. It is well supported by illustrations, which appear regularly. Reed Hastings started Netflix with Marc Randolph in 1997. Their company has completely changed how we watch TV and films. In this book, Reed explains the secret to the company's success and how at Netflix, there really are NO rules.

    • Czas na zmiany. Bądź całkowicie szczery. Pamiętaj, że firma to zespół, a nie rodzina. I nigdy, przenigdy nie staraj się zadowolić swojego szefa. Oto niektóre z podstawowych reguł, jakie obowiązują pracowników Netflixa. Działanie tego przedsiębiorstwa to kulturowy eksperyment, który zakończył się spektakularnym sukcesem: firma zajmująca się korespondencyjnym wypożyczaniem płyt DVD stała się streamingową potęgą. Ma obecnie 182 miliony subskrybentów i kapitalizację rynkową na poziomie Disneya. Reed Hastings – prezes i CEO Netflixa – po raz pierwszy dzieli się sekretami, które zrewolucjonizowały branżę rozrywkową i technologiczną. Wspólnie z Erin Meyer, profesor INSEAD Business School, ujawnia swoją filozofię przywództwa odrzucającą przekonania, zgodnie z którymi działa większość firm. Od nielimitowanych urlopów do rezygnacji z zatwierdzania wydatków pracowników – Netflix to zupełnie inny sposób prowadzenia organizacji, który najlepiej pasuje do zmieniającego się świata. "Gdy regułą jest brak reguł" to inspiracja do zmiany dla wszystkich, którzy poszukują źródeł produktywności, kreatywności i innowacji.

    • „Než přišel Netflix, nikdy předtím neexistovala společnost jako Netflix.“ Tato revoluční firma generuje miliardové roční příjmy a oslovuje stovky milionů lidí ve více než 190 zemích. Klíčovým faktorem úspěchu je kultura nastavená Reedem Hastingsem, která může na první pohled působit radikálně. Díky této kultuře zaměřené na svobodu a odpovědnost se Netflix dostal na vrchol. V tomto světovém bestselleru spoluzakladatel Hastings odhaluje vnitřní fungování Netflixu: jak nastavuje nové standardy, váží si lidí více než procesů, upřednostňuje inovace před efektivitou a zaměstnance nekontroluje. Neexistují žádná pravidla pro dovolenou ani výdaje. Zaměstnanci se nesnaží potěšit své nadřízené, ale poskytují upřímnou zpětnou vazbu. Tyto neobvyklé metody vedly k bezkonkurenční rychlosti inovací a Netflix se stal jednou z nejoblíbenějších značek na světě. Tato kniha je výbornou a čtivou byznysovou příručkou, která dramaticky proplétá historii Netflixu. Je určena pro ty, kdo vedou týmy, firmy, budují startupy nebo pracují v organizacích, které chtějí zlepšovat.
